About Leith Shore

Leith Shore, situated on the banks of the Water of Leith in Edinburgh, Scotland, is a vibrant and historic waterfront area. Once a bustling port, Leith has transformed into a trendy district filled with a mix of historic charm and modern attractions. Explore the picturesque streets lined with Georgian and Victorian buildings, home to a variety of independent shops, boutiques, cafes, and restaurants. The shore is renowned for its culinary scene, offering a diverse range of cuisines, from traditional Scottish fare to international delights. Enjoy a leisurely walk along the waterfront promenade, where you can admire the views of the harbor, watch the boats go by, and visit popular landmarks such as the Royal Yacht Britannia. Leith Shore is also home to cultural attractions such as the Scottish National Gallery of Modern Art and the vibrant Leith Theatre. With its lively atmosphere, rich history, and diverse offerings, Leith Shore is a must-visit destination for both locals and tourists.
